With its swish setting inside Holland Park, the Belvedere is the kind of restaurant you want to dress up for, whether or not you're off to the opera afterwards. It's easy to imagine yourself in an art deco hotel lounge, with gilt mirrors, oriental-patterned wallpapers and the piano tinkling away as you enter the room; all that's missing is Hercule Poirot. There are playful touches, with bright artwork like Warhol's Marilyn Monroe to dilute the sense that you're in a period piece.

Likewise, the menu features some slightly incongruous items, with fish and chips sitting alongside the Franco-Italian classics. There's also a selection of Sunday roasts - with jus, not gravy. Back on track, the wine list places formidable French vintages to the fore. Staying more or less across the Channel, a chicory salad combined two colours of the bitter leaf, with the right balance of roquefort, pears and walnuts. Calf's liver was nicely charred, and paired with an intense sauce diable, but tuna steak with aubergine caviar had a slightly mushy texture and was under-seasoned. Oddly, the waiters offer a grinding of black pepper over every dish, Pizza Express-style, but they serve their white-haired and well-to-do clientele with smooth efficiency.
